The Difference Between Traditional and Augmented Reality Games

  • Traditional Games: Rely on a 2D or 3D screen, where the player interacts within a virtual environment, but it remains confined to the device.
  • Augmented Reality (AR) Games: Merge the digital world with your real life. For example, imagine playing a car race on your living room table or a puzzle game that appears on your house wall.

🕶️The fundamental difference is that AR games elevate the level of interaction and engagement, making players feel like they are an actual part of the game, not just spectators.

The Most Used Augmented Reality (AR) Game Development Tools

The Most Used Augmented Reality (AR) Game Development Tools
Game Development

When you’re thinking about developing augmented reality (AR) video games, the most important step after an idea is choosing the right tools and software platforms. The right tools help you save time, reduce costs, and ensure a smooth user experience.

Among the most prominent augmented reality game development tools that developers rely on globally are:

  • Unity with AR Foundation: The most popular choice for beginners and professionals due to its compatibility with iOS and Android.
  • Vuforia: An advanced platform for tracking images and objects in an AR environment.
  • ARKit (iOS): An official tool from Apple for developing AR games on iPhones and iPads.
  • ARCore (Android): A tool provided by Google for building powerful AR games on Android phones.
  • Unreal Engine: Suitable for developing high-quality 3D games with integrated technical support for augmented reality.

How to Choose the Right Tool to Develop Your Video Game?

Choosing the tool depends on:

  1. Game Goal: Is it educational, entertainment, or marketing?
  2. Target Audience: Games for children need light and easy-to-use tools, while combat or strategy games require advanced platforms.
  3. Budget: If you’re a startup, you’ll need an economical solution that reduces cost while maintaining performance.
  4. Technical Support and Community: Tools like Unity and Unreal have huge communities of developers, which makes it easy to solve problems quickly.

Technical Problems Facing AR Game Developers

Among the most prominent problems facing developers are:

  • Device compatibility: Not all phones fully support AR technologies.
  • Battery and processor consumption: Running augmented reality elements consumes a significant amount of device resources.
  • Motion and location tracking problems: Poor accuracy in recognizing the environment can lead to an unsatisfactory user experience.
  • High costs for startups: They may find it difficult to fund an AR game project from the start.

Innovative Solutions to Improve Performance and User Experience

Fortunately, there are several practical solutions that can ensure the game’s success:

  • Using augmented reality game development tools like ARCore and ARKit to ensure wider device compatibility.
  • Compressing data and graphics to reduce battery consumption.
  • Relying on Artificial Intelligence (AI) to improve tracking and interaction with the environment.
